She shall not, she shall not be moved. Joan Rivers, in protest of store's refusal to sell her New York Times bestseller, I Hate Everyone ... Starting With Me, made an unannounced visit to a Burbank Costco, megaphone and handcuffs in tow. She signed copies of her books and cuffed herself to a cart, until a cop escorted her off the premises.
The store has banned the book because of two made up quotes on the book's back cover. One, from Marie Antoinette, reads, "Let Her Eat Shit." The other, from Wilt Chamberlain, says "If I were alive, even I wouldn't fuck her."
"This is a store that sells 300 rolls of toilet paper at the same time, and I say any customer that buys 300 rolls of toilet paper deserves a funny book to sit on the toilet and read," said the 79-year-old comic.
Though Rivers believes that her First Amendment rights were violated, she will not boycott the store. She tells KABC, "I am a Costco cardholder. I have bought my condoms there and will continue to do so. I am an avid, avid shopper in their sex toy department."
No charges were filed. Check out the video below:
